The Register » Software » Man dies playing computer games86 hours on the goPublished Thursday 10th October 2002 13:50 GMT A South Korean man died after a marathon session playing computer games. The unemployed man was discovered in the toilets of an Internet café in Kwangju, 160 miles south-west of Seoul. According to Ananova, he collapsed and died after playing computer games for 86 hours non-stop without food or sleep. In February a mother from Louisiana sued Nintendo for "unspecified damages" after her son died during a marathon session playing games. The game player hit his head on a table during a seizure while playing with the console. ® Related Story
